Fantastic, after being a little gun shy after the terrible job that Sears had done, we were apprehensive about another contractor. Found Aston on Angies list and went for it. He arrived early for the estimate and was thorough and explained exactly what was involved. He said he would fix all of the areas around the windows that Sears had screwed up, i.e uneven wallboard, large voids etc. On the day of the job he arrived exactly when he said he would and went right to work preparing both rooms, plastic on the walls and furniture, floors covered, windows masked and covered. Very particular in his prep. of the rooms and walls. A true mark of someone who is proud of his accomplishments and professionalism. He first tapped all of the joints and large voids, primed the walls and applied a scratch coat. After letting the scratch dry, he applied two finish coats. The repaired area is smoother that the original walls. He cleaned up the areas completely, unlike Sears, and gave me thorough instructions on how long to let it dry before painting and reattaching the molding. He was not rushed and very congenial, a very pleasant experience. I do have more work for him and will definitely be contacting him to remove some acoustic in our bedroom.
Description of Work: Needed to finish interior walls in two rooms from a very sloppy window installation done by Sears Home Improvement. Drywall was installed by the Sears contractor, however I asked him not to tape it, when he admitted that he was not very good at tapping and finishing drywall. I needed to remove all of the molding they put in and realized that without silicon, the defects in the wall were very evident. Sears agreed to have me contact an independent drywall contrator and they would pay for it.

We recently replaced a extremely large older kitchen window with a smaller, more efficient one, and as a result, needed a large area of the outside wall patched with stucco. Aston came over and gave us a verbal estimate and then followed up that estimate with a written one via email. We decided quite quickly to choose his services because of the rave reviews here on Angie's list and the great impression he left with my husband during his visit. He completed the stucco in 2 visits. The first visit was to put the tar paper, mesh wire, and then a base coat. We let that dry for 4 days, and then he came back for the finish coat. He took great care in protecting the new window with plastic and the cement patio by laying down plastic and then cleaned up after himself. The wall looks wonderful and one would never know there was a patch there. I think the job was worth the cost and Aston is a true artist.
Description of Work: Patched a large stucco hole on the exterior of the house that was made when we replaced a large older kitchen window with a smaller one. The area needed to be patched with stucco to match the rest of the house.

Aston removed all old Wainscot, insulated the area and then covered with two coats of 60 minute paper. He then completed the brown and scratch coating and then waited the several days required before the final stucco top coat was completed. The job came out very good. Aston did a great job matching the existing stucco. Aston was neat, courteous, punctual, and communicated everything that was going on to both my wife and I. When he completed the job, he cleaned up the area to just the way it was before the work was started. Appx. one week after he completed the work, there were a couple small cracks around windows (nothing unusual for such a large stucco job). We contacted Aston and he was here the next day to take a look at what was going on. He came back a couple days later to repair and re-float the whole front again. This was not necessary but Aston really goes the extra mile to ensure we were pleased...and we were!!! We would definitely use Aston again and have already recommended him to several friends that are thinking about some outside and inside work. Thanks again Aston and good luck!
Description of Work: Aston removed old Wainscoting from the front of our one story ranch home in Orange. The area was appx. 40ft. long by 9ft. high wiht several windows. We also asked him to change the entryway from brick to matching stucco. This was the front of the house and very visible from the street so it needed to come out good.

Description of Work: The stucco repair area was around the electric service panel that was removed and upgraded to 200A service. The new electric service panel is about 1-foot taller than the original 100A panel, so the electrician had to remove stucco on all four sides of the old panel, including about 3-feet above the old panel. This made clearance for the taller replacement panel, plus room to maneuver the power cables into the top of the new panel. Patchworks filled-in the open area around the new panel and roughed-up the stucco next to the open area to blend the replacement stucco texture into the existing stucco texture. Description of Work: Repaired a 3 foot by 6 foot hole in exterior wall.after plumbing repair. Lathed the hole with new 60 minute paper and wire, applied cement scratch and brown coat. Finished with 100 La Habra stucco to match finish.. Patched several smaller areas of damaged stucco.
